User Identification by Hierarchical Fingerprint and Palmprint Matching

Abstract

Biometric Identification system has high efficiency, high recognition rate and comfortable to user’s operating characteristics. Fingerprint and Palmprint are the most common authentic biometrics for personal identification, especially for forensic security. Fingerprint and Palmprint authentication system is considered to be the most reliable biometric recognition due to its merits such as low-cost, user-friendliness, high speed and accuracy. In this paper, a novel hierarchical minutiae matching algorithm for fingerprint and palmprint identification system is proposed. This method decomposes the matching stop into several stages and rejects many false fingerprints on different stages, thus it can save time while preserving a high identification rate. Real time images are captured using a scanner. Each of these gray-scale images are aligned and then used to extract fingerprint and palmprint features. A hierarchical matching system that is used to reduce the computation cost by segmenting the image and matching it with the database, thereby false fingerprints are rejected in the subsequent changes by comparing just a portion of the whole fingerprint and palmprint. The hierarchical strategy can reject many fingerprint ( in the database of the AFIS ) which do not belong to the same finger as the input fingerprint quickly, thus it can save much time.
